DISTRICT NEWS.

GNEWHERO. Mrs Cheeseman and Miss Ellis arc taking a much needed holiday in Auckland, where they are the guests of Mrs Hete, of Dominion Road. Mr Williams has been very seriously ill with bronchial pneumonia, but is now well on the way £o recovery. Mrs Cheeseman has been very kindly looking after the case. The lady in question is a fully qualified nurse, and we are fortunate in having her i” our district, although one natur-

ally feels one must not trespass too much on her good nature, Mrs Scoble Cornish has returned home. She was taken seriously ill in Auckland, but is slowly recover-

Mr and Mrs Kiley-Taylor are still “down south.” Mr Riley-Taylor is enjoying some very good runs with the local Hunt Club. Mr and Mrs Paul .Geraghtv have moved into their new heme at Tuakau. They will be greatly missed he re.

Mr Biddick has had a very bad time in Hamilton Hospital, but he is home again minus a finger. At one time there was great fear ho might have to Kse an.arm, but all danger of that is over. The accident was a simple one, merely a prick from barb wire, but it had far-reaching consequences. During his absence his fifteen-year-s< n l\ad the misfortune to break his arm. Mr T. Mu'r, at a recent meet mg held with a view to erect an up-to-date hall on the Domain,, amde a very sound suggestion, vij.. that we should get an expert up to suggest the most suitable site for the hall and generously offered £5 towards .‘the cost.
